On August 17, Viavi Solutions rose 5.21% in regular trading, trading at $45.66/share, with turnover of $19.24 million. The rally reflects continued market enthusiasm following the company's fiscal Q4 earnings report released on August 5, which significantly exceeded expectations.
Specifically, Viavi reported adjusted EPS of $0.34, beating the consensus estimate of $0.30, while revenue came in at $443.1 million versus the $432.6 million expected, representing a 52.5% year-over-year increase. More notably, the company issued fiscal Q1 guidance of $0.40 to $0.42 in adjusted EPS on revenue of $450 million to $460 million, far surpassing analyst expectations of $0.28 EPS on $432.2 million in revenue. B. Riley maintained a Buy rating with a $60 price target.
Additionally, the company has recently launched multiple new products across AI network validation for Ultra Ethernet fabrics, secured $1.1 million in EU funding for a 6G security project, and publicly noted smooth progress on co-packaged optics (CPO), reinforcing market expectations for AI-related test solution order fulfillment.
